随着比特币和其他加密货币的普及,越来越多的人开始关注如何安全存储自己的数字资产。在这一过程中,比特币冷钱包作为一种广受欢迎的存储方式,成为了很多用户的首选。而关于比特币冷钱包中的私钥格式,大家也有诸多疑问。本文将详细介绍比特币冷钱包私钥格式,并为大家解答一些常见的问题,帮助你更好地理解这一重要概念。
比特币冷钱包是指一种将比特币私钥离线存储的方式,使用户能够在不连接互联网的情况下,保存自己的加密货币资产。冷钱包的安全性在于,它可以避免黑客攻击和恶意软件的威胁,给用户提供了更加安心的存储方案。相比之下,与在线服务(如热钱包)对应的冷钱包大大减少了被攻击的风险。
冷钱包有几种主要形式,包括纸钱包、硬件钱包和甚至某些特定的离线设备。用户在使用冷钱包时,需要生成私钥,并将其安全存储,以确保自己的数字资产不受到外部攻击。
在讨论比特币冷钱包私钥格式之前,我们需要了解私钥的概念。比特币私钥是一个随机生成的256位长的数字,用于证明用户对某个比特币地址的控制权。用户凭借私钥可以签署交易,允许比特币在区块链上转移。
比特币私钥的格式主要有两种:WIF(Wallet Import Format)格式和十六进制格式。WIF是私钥的一种编码方式,更易于人类使用和存储,而十六进制格式则是更原始、低级的表示方式。
WIF格式是将私钥进行Base58Check编码后形成的一种格式,通常以字母“5”、“K”或“L”开头。WIF格式在生成和备份冷钱包时非常常用,因为它较短且包含了Checksum,用于校验私钥的有效性。在使用冷钱包时,用户可以轻松地将WIF格式的私钥导入到其他钱包中。
十六进制格式则是比特币私钥的原始表示方式。它通常是一个64个字符长的字符串,由数字和字母组成,仅仅以“0x”作为前缀。相比WIF格式,十六进制格式虽然更难以识别,但在某些技术上更具透明性,因为它没有任何其他的元数据或校验功能。
生成冷钱包私钥的过程通常需要使用专门的软件来确保其安全性。首先,用户需要选择一个信誉良好的冷钱包软件或者硬件设备。根据设备和软件的不同,生成私钥的具体步骤可能有所不同,但通常可以按照以下步骤进行:
第一,下载或准备好冷钱包软件,确保在安全的环境中操作,建议使用离线计算机。接下来,启动冷钱包软件,选择“生成私钥”功能。软件在生成私钥时,会使用安全的随机数生成器来确保私钥的随机性和安全性。一旦生成,用户将看到私钥以WIF或十六进制格式展现。接着,用户需要将私钥安全地保存下来,避免任何未经授权的访问。值得注意的是,重复备份可以增加安全系数,建议将私钥存储在不同的物理位置,并使用防火措施确保其安全。
私钥的安全性至关重要,因为一旦私钥泄露,就意味着黑客可以完全控制相应的钱包及其存储的比特币。为了有效保护私钥的安全性,用户需要采取以下措施:
首先,避免将私钥存储在联网的设备上。私钥应保存在离线环境中,例如纸上或硬件钱包中。第二,确保私钥的备份安全、可靠,并采取加密措施进行保护。有人建议使用不容易被物理损坏的材料,例如金属来保存私钥的备份。第三,定期更新冷钱包并使用安全的造钱包软件,同时确保所使用的硬件钱包来自可信赖的制造商。最后,用户需要提升针对社工攻击和钓鱼攻击的警惕性,知道在任何情况下都不应轻易透露私钥。
将冷钱包的私钥导入热钱包通常比较简单,但需要谨慎操作。首先,用户需要选择一个合适的热钱包应用,确保它的安全性和用户口碑。随后,在热钱包的“导入私钥”功能中,输入冷钱包中的私钥。建议使用WIF格式,因为它在输入时更为方便。
根据热钱包的要求,用户可以需要在确认界面上确认导入,然后根据提示进行操作。一旦私钥成功导入,用户的比特币就会在热钱包中显示。需要注意的是,在导入私钥完成后的操作中,不要重复使用和传播该密钥,以避免增加被盗风险。
如果用户不小心遗失了冷钱包的私钥或备份,恢复资产将变得极其困难,甚至可能完全丧失。因此,事先的备份工作至关重要。假如发生私钥丢失,用户首先应该尝试回忆和审核可能的备份。许多用户会将私钥保存在安全的地方,如保险箱、邮寄给信任的朋友或家人或使用保险服务等。如果确认找不到私钥,用户可以断定该比特币资产将无法恢复,这也提醒大家在开始使用比特币等数字资产时,务必要做好风险评估。
在理论上,一个私钥可以写成多种格式,例如用户可以将私钥以十六进制格式转换为WIF格式。这是由于底层的私钥本质是一致的,转换只是格式上的变化。如果用户需要从一种格式转换为另一种格式,可以使用相关的在线工具,或者直接用加密库进行访问。但在进行此类转换时,务必确保使用信誉良好的软件/工具,并避免暴露私钥。任何状态下泄露私钥都可能导致资金损失。
总结而言,比特币冷钱包作为一种安全的存储方式,对于普通用户来说,深刻理解私钥的格式与管理则有利于保护自己的数字资产。对于大多数用户来说,合理使用冷钱包并注重私钥的安全,可以为他们带来更为安心的加密货币投资体验。